USB PD power supply, also known as USB Power Delivery technology, is a new standard in charging technology that promises faster and more efficient charging for electronic devices. This technology allows for up to 100 watts of power output, which means it can charge laptops, tablets, smartphones, and other devices at lightning-fast speeds. In this article, we will explore what USB PD power supply is, how it works, and its benefits.
What is USB PD Power Supply?
USB PD power supply is a standard for charging electronic devices over USB connections. The technology is based on the USB Type-C standard, which allows for higher data transfer rates and more power delivery capabilities than previous USB versions.
How Does USB PD Power Supply Work?
USB PD power supply works by negotiating the maximum power output between the device and the charger. To put it simply, the device tells the charger how much power it needs, and the charger delivers that power accordingly. This negotiation process happens automatically when a device is connected to a USB PD charger.
The beauty of USB PD power supply is its ability to adjust the power output dynamically. For instance, if you connect a smartphone to a USB PD charger, it will deliver just enough power to charge the battery efficiently. Likewise, if a laptop is connected to the same charger, it will increase the power output to charge the battery efficiently.
Benefits of USB PD Power Supply
There are several benefits to using USB PD power supply, which include the following:
1. Faster Charging: USB PD power supply is capable of delivering up to 100 watts of power, which means faster charging times for devices. This speed is particularly useful for devices that have larger battery capacities, such as laptops and tablets.
2. Universal Compatibility: The USB PD standard is compatible with a wide range of electronic devices, including smartphones, tablets, laptops, and more. This means you can use the same charger for multiple devices, reducing clutter and simplifying charging needs.
3. Increased Efficiency: USB PD power supply is more efficient than traditional charging methods, which means it wastes less energy and saves money on electricity bills.
4. Safe Charging: USB PD power supply comes with built-in protection mechanisms to prevent overcharging, overheating, and short-circuiting. This ensures safe charging for your devices, even when charging multiple devices simultaneously.
